Architectural Characteristics: Distinctive Elements and Traits

Architectural characteristics encompass diverse elements and traits that define an edifice's style, form, and function. Such characteristics can include various aspects, such as structural systems, materials, decorative motifs, and spatial arrangements.

Recognizing these characteristics allows architects, historians, and appreciators to analyze the historical context, cultural influences, and artistic intent behind a building's design.

The selection of materials, for example, can reflect the technological advancements of an era or the presence of resources in a particular region. Similarly, the use of decorative elements, like carvings, often express cultural values and beliefs.

By examining these unique traits, we can gain a deeper understanding into the rich legacy embedded within architectural masterpieces.

Comprehending Architecture: Definitions, Concepts, and Applications

Architecture encompasses the science of designing and constructing buildings and other physical structures. It involves a multifaceted interplay of functional requirements, aesthetic considerations, and technical limitations.

At its core, architecture seeks to create operable spaces that elevate the human experience. Architects utilize their expertise in a wide range of areas, including structural design, building materials, and environmental responsibility.

  • Definitions of architecture often emphasize its comprehensive nature, considering not just the physical structure but also its context within the surrounding environment.
  • Ideas such as form follows function, spatial organization, and materiality play a crucial role in shaping architectural design.
  • Applications of architecture can be found in wide-ranging fields, including residential, commercial, institutional, and infrastructural projects.

Design continues to evolve with advancements in technology, innovation, and societal needs. The field constantly strives to create buildings that are not only aesthetically pleasing but also environmentally responsible, adaptable to changing conditions, and enriching for the people who inhabit them.
